Why Tapeworm Medication for Cats Is Necessary

I learned that tapeworm medication for cats is important because these parasites do not go away on their own. When my cat had tapeworms, I noticed signs like scooting, weight loss, and tiny rice-like segments near the tail. Without treatment, the worms kept taking nutrients from my cat’s body, which made me realize how quickly a small problem can become a bigger health issue.

I also found that treating tapeworms protects my cat’s overall comfort and well-being. Tapeworms can cause irritation, digestive upset, and general weakness, especially if the infestation lasts too long. Giving the proper medication helped my cat feel better and prevented the infection from lingering.

Another reason I consider tapeworm medicine necessary is that it helps stop the cycle of reinfection. In my experience, tapeworms are often spread through fleas, so treating only the cat is not enough if the flea problem is still there. Using medication along with flea control gave me peace of mind that I was addressing the root cause, not just the symptoms.

What I Look For Before Buying

When I shop for tapeworm medication for cats, I always check a few key things first:

  • Active ingredient: I look for ingredients known to treat tapeworms, such as praziquantel.
  • Cat-specific formula: I only choose products made specifically for cats, never dog medication.
  • Age and weight requirements: I make sure the product matches my cat’s size and age.
  • Ease of use: I consider whether my cat will take a tablet, liquid, or topical treatment more easily.
  • Veterinary approval: I prefer products recommended by a vet or backed by clear instructions.

Types of Tapeworm Medication I Consider

In my experience, tapeworm treatments usually come in a few forms:

  • Oral tablets: These often work well, but my cat may resist taking them.
  • Chewable tablets: These can be easier if my cat accepts treats.
  • Liquid medicine: I find this helpful when a cat won’t swallow pills.
  • Topical treatments: Some products are applied to the skin and may also help with other parasites.

Why I Pay Attention to the Active Ingredient

The active ingredient matters more to me than fancy packaging. I have learned that praziquantel is one of the most common and effective ingredients for tapeworms in cats. If I’m unsure, I always read the label carefully or ask my vet before buying.

What I Check for Safety

Safety is my biggest concern. I always read the dosage instructions and warnings before giving any medication to my cat. I also avoid products meant for dogs, since some ingredients can be dangerous for cats. If my cat is pregnant, very young, elderly, or has health issues, I consult a vet first.

How I Decide Between Over-the-Counter and Prescription Options

Sometimes I can find over-the-counter tapeworm medication, but other times I prefer a prescription product. If my cat has recurring parasites or other symptoms, I trust my vet to recommend the best option. For me, prescription treatments can offer more confidence when the situation feels serious.

My Tips for Giving the Medication

Giving medicine to a cat can be tricky, so I always try to make the process as calm as possible. I use a small treat, follow the dosage exactly, and keep my cat comfortable. If the medication is hard to give, I ask my vet or pharmacist for tips on administration.

What Else I Do Besides Medication

I’ve learned that treating tapeworms is not just about the medicine. I also clean my cat’s bedding, vacuum often, and control fleas, since fleas are a common source of tapeworms. If I don’t deal with the flea problem, the tapeworms can come back.
